Question: In a national election, if 65% of the votes are in favor of a candidate and there are 1,000,000 votes cast, how many votes did the candidate receive?

Options:

  1. 650,000
  2. 600,000
  3. 700,000
  4. 750,000

Correct Answer: 650,000

Solution:

Votes received = 1,000,000 * 0.65 = 650,000.

In a national election, if 65% of the votes are in favor of a candidate and there are 1,000,000 votes cast, how many votes did the candidate receive?
  • Step 1: Understand that 65% means 65 out of every 100 votes.
  • Step 2: Convert the percentage to a decimal by dividing 65 by 100, which gives you 0.65.
  • Step 3: Multiply the total number of votes (1,000,000) by the decimal (0.65) to find the number of votes for the candidate.
  • Step 4: Calculate 1,000,000 * 0.65, which equals 650,000.
